Output 62ca859f962fc5ca01aae767c576477c7df88d53c9515fd6803b3272edfc2447:2

value
307664
script pubkey
OP_HASH160 OP_PUSHBYTES_20 64f92df4eba680cab29b3878210deea4f54ccbc6 OP_EQUAL
address
3Atv12JVrz8QC1MiDUtTZzFijQoTufKG2H
transaction
62ca859f962fc5ca01aae767c576477c7df88d53c9515fd6803b3272edfc2447
confirmations
226290
spent
true